Specialized Skills – Targeting Officer

Location:  Washington, District of Columbia, United States

Job Description:
The Targeting Officer is primarily
based in the Washington, DC area with some opportunities for tours and short
assignments overseas. In today’s fast-paced and technologically savvy world,
targeting is critical to the success of the customer’s global mission. Officers
in this career track will directly support and drive complex worldwide customer
operations to develop actionable intelligence against the highest priority
threats to U.S. national security.
Targeting Officers are specialists
who bring unique skills necessary for enhanced exploitation of transnational
issues and difficult target sets. SSO-T’s develop in-depth, substantive
expertise geared towards customer operations. They research and analyze complex
datasets, develop strategic overviews of targets, and generate leads to advance
overseas operations. Effective SSO-Ts are inquisitive, investigative, and
action-oriented. They must be able to synthesize large – often nonspecific –
datasets and intelligence into a strategic picture and clearly and concisely
convey it to non-expert audiences. They require strong organizational and
communication skills (both verbal and written). Officers selected for this
occupation will be trained and certified in the SSO-T career track and afforded
opportunities to work in overseas operating environments if they are interested
in doing so.
